For those unfamiliar with the series, Love on the Spectrum is a Netflix reality show that follows individuals with autism as they navigate the world of dating. Love on the Spectrum Season 3 featured returning stars Connor, James, Dani, Abbey, David, Tanner, and Adan along with fresh faces in Madison and Pari. The new season gave Netflix subscribers an update on the previously-established relationships with Dani & Adan and Abbey & David as the other members of the cast went on dates with new people.

Now that Season 3 is over, Love on the Spectrum fans may wonder which couples are still together. Season 3 saw Connor successfully paired with Georgie, while Tanner went on multiple dates with Callie. The season also showcased the heartbreaking end of Adan and Dani's relationship, and saw Madison and Pari hit it off with their dates, Tyler and Tina, respectively. While the end credits gave fans some idea of where the couples are today, social media posts and official word from Netflix since then have offered more up-to-date information about the show's couples post-Season 3.
Love on the Spectrum Season 3: Which Couples Are Still Together?
- Abbey and David - Still together
- Connor and Georgie - Still together
- Tanner and Callie - Not together
- Adan and Dani - Not together. Dani is currently in a new relationship with someone who was not on the show.
- Madison and Tyler - Still together
- Pari and Tina - Still together
- James and Shelley - Still together
With Love on the Spectrum Season 3 over, fans are no doubt wondering if the show will return for Season 4. At the time of this writing, Love on the Spectrum has not been renewed for a fourth season, but the show's popularity makes it seem likely that another season will happen. With so many couples still together after the conclusion of Love on the Spectrum Season 3, it would be interesting to see if Season 4 continued to follow those couples or if a new season of the Netflix reality show would instead focus on a brand-new cast.
